langchain_experimental.autonomous_agents.hugginggpt.task_planner
.BasePlanner¶
- class langchain_experimental.autonomous_agents.hugginggpt.task_planner.BasePlanner[source]¶
Bases:
BaseModel
规划器的基类。
通过解析和验证从关键字参数传来的输入数据来创建一个新的模型。
如果输入数据无法解析成有效的模型,将引发`ValidationError`。
- 抽象 异步 aplan(inputs: dict, callbacks: Optional[Union[List[BaseCallbackHandler], BaseCallbackManager]] = None, **kwargs: Any) Plan [源代码]¶
异步:给定输入,决定要做什么。
- 参数
inputs (dict) –
callbacks (Optional[Union[List[BaseCallbackHandler], BaseCallbackManager]]]) –
kwargs (Any) –
- 返回类型
- 摘要 plan(inputs: dict, callbacks: Optional[Union[List[BaseCallbackHandler], BaseCallbackManager]] = None, **kwargs: Any) Plan [source]¶
给定输入,决定要做什么。
- 参数
inputs (dict) –
callbacks (Optional[Union[List[BaseCallbackHandler], BaseCallbackManager]]]) –
kwargs (Any) –
- 返回类型